Egypt and Jordan on Monday strongly condemned Israel's demolition of an old hotel in east Jerusalem, a symbolic building for the Palestinians, and warned against the risk of violence.
Egypt "condemns" the demolition of the old Shepherd Hotel, in the Palestinian neighborhood of Sheikh Jarrah, and argues that continuing Israeli settlement projects will lead to a "new explosion of violence" in the Palestinian territories," warns a statement Egyptian Foreign Affairs.
